The Evolutionary Origins and Functional Morphology of Vertebrate Flight Across Pterosaurs, Birds, and Bats

Quick fact

Pterosaurs, birds, and bats each evolved powered flight independently—pterosaurs first, about 228 million years ago; birds next, about 150 million years ago; and bats last, around 50 million years ago. Yet each used a different skeletal structure: pterosaurs flew on a membrane stretched from an elongated fourth finger, birds on feathers attached to a fused hand, and bats on a membrane supported by elongated fingers two through five.
